The New Year’s Eve holiday season calls for memorable adventures, and what better way to celebrate than a road trip with friends? Recently, my friends and I embarked on a five-day, 1500-kilometer journey from Mumbai to Goa and back, with the Kia Seltos HTK+ Diesel Manual as our trusted steed. Here’s a detailed review of the car’s performance, comfort, and roadworthiness, based on our firsthand experience.
For a diesel car loaded with five people and a boot full of luggage, fuel economy plays a critical role in the journey. The Kia Seltos managed an impressive mileage of 14.8 to 15 kmpl over varied terrain, which included highways, winding ghat roads, and the occasional traffic-clogged city streets. We used approximately ₹7,600 worth of diesel, which felt reasonable given the distance covered. The engine’s refined performance ensured steady power delivery without compromising too much on fuel efficiency.
What truly elevated our road trip experience was the car’s impressive array of comfort-focused features.
1. Spacious Cabin
The Kia Seltos HTK+ offered ample space for five adults, ensuring that no one felt cramped even after hours on the road. The rear seats, in particular, provided good legroom and shoulder space for three passengers.
2. Ventilated Seats
Driving through the humid coastal regions can be exhausting, but the ventilated seats proved to be a game-changer. They kept the driver and front passenger cool, even during the midday heat.
3. Panoramic Sunroof
The panoramic sunroof added a sense of openness to the cabin and brought a refreshing vibe to the journey. It allowed us to enjoy the clear blue skies during the day and the starlit views at night, adding to the scenic charm of our road trip.
4. Apple CarPlay Integration
Seamless smartphone connectivity via Apple CarPlay made navigation, entertainment, and communication effortless. Streaming music and using maps felt intuitive, enhancing the overall driving experience.
The Kia Seltos HTK+ Diesel Manual is powered by a 1.5-liter CRDi engine that delivers 114 bhp and 250 Nm of torque, offering sufficient power for both city commutes and highway cruising. The 6-speed manual gearbox was responsive, making overtaking maneuvers on the highway a breeze. The engine remained composed even during steep climbs on the ghats, ensuring a hassle-free drive.
However, the ride quality left us wanting more. With five people on board and a fully loaded boot, the suspension struggled to absorb road imperfections, particularly on uneven and bumpy roads. The stiff setup made the ride feel jarring at times, detracting from the otherwise smooth driving experience. On well-paved highways, the ride quality improved significantly, with minimal cabin noise and excellent stability at higher speeds.
The Seltos is a head-turner, and its bold styling undoubtedly adds to its appeal. The sharp LED headlamps, signature tiger-nose grille, and well-sculpted body lines make it stand out on the road. During our trip, it garnered quite a few appreciative glances, underscoring its aspirational design.
For a road trip with friends, luggage space is non-negotiable, and the Kia Seltos delivered on this front. The 433-liter boot capacity easily accommodated all our bags, with room to spare for souvenirs from Goa. Loading and unloading were straightforward, thanks to the wide-opening tailgate.
The Seltos handled corners confidently, offering good grip even on winding ghat roads. The steering felt well-weighted, though it could have been slightly more responsive for better precision. In terms of safety, the HTK+ variant is equipped with dual airbags, ABS with EBD, and rear parking sensors, which provided peace of mind throughout the journey.
Pros
• Fuel-efficient diesel engine
• Spacious and comfortable cabin
• Ventilated seats and panoramic sunroof enhance long drives
• Stylish and premium design
• Ample boot space for luggage
Cons
• Stiff suspension leads to a bumpy ride on rough roads
• Slightly limited steering feedback
• Ride quality could be improved under full load
The Kia Seltos HTK+ Diesel Manual is a well-rounded compact SUV that excels in design, comfort, and fuel efficiency, making it a great choice for road trips and daily commutes alike. While the ride quality could benefit from a more forgiving suspension setup, its long list of features and practicality easily outweigh this minor drawback.
